S.T.A.G.E. on 05 August 2009
| SciFiBoy said: if Live was Totally Free, it would be Totally awesome like, Totally ftw, huh? |
It is so sad to see how so many people say Xbox Live would be awesome if it is free. It is enlightening to that they think it is awesome as is.







